SORU
9 Aralık 2009, ÇARŞAMBA


CSV viewer?komut satırı

Kimse Linux için komut satırı CSV görüntüleyici biliyor OS X? less ama daha okunaklı bir şekilde sütun boşluk böyle bir şey düşünüyorum. (OpenOffice Calc veya Excel ile açarak ince olurdu, ama bu şekilde de etkisiz hale getirdi sadecebakıyorverileri gibi ihtiyacım var.) Yatay ve dikey kaydırma olması harika olurdu.

CEVAP
27 EYLÜL 2010, PAZARTESİ


Ayrıca bu kullanabilirsiniz:

column -s, -t < somefile.csv | less -#2 -N -S

column çok kullanışlı her sütunun genişliğini uygun bulduğu ... ... ve güzelce biçimlendirilmiş bir tablo olarak metni görüntüler, standart bir unıx programıdır.

Not: sütun aşağıdaki sütunları ile birleştirilmiş bir başka boş alanlar, her yer tutucu bir çeşit koyun. Aşağıdaki örnek ekleme sed kullanmak için nasıl bir yer tutucu gösterir:

$ cat data.csv
1,2,3,4,5
1,,,,5
$ sed 's/,,/, ,/g;s/,,/, ,/g' data.csv | column -s, -t
1  2  3  4  5
1           5
$ cat data.csv
1,2,3,4,5
1,,,,5
$ column -s, -t < data.csv
1  2  3  4  5
1  5
$ sed 's/,,/, ,/g;s/,,/, ,/g' data.csv | column -s, -t
1  2  3  4  5
1           5

, , ,, yerine iki kez yapılır unutmayın. Eğer bunu yaparsanız, bunu sadece bir kez 1,,,4 ikinci virgül zaten uyumlu olduğundan 1, ,,4 olacak.

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• 07cadikiz07

    07cadikiz07

    17 EKİM 2007
  • incognitotraveler

    incognitotra

    27 Mayıs 2010
  • Tracy Hairston

    Tracy Hairst

    22 Mayıs 2009